The Baptist Church on corner of Lordship Lane and Goodrich Rd used to take them - they host ( or used to ) a drop in session for ayslum seekers/refugees on Tuesdays and needed them for distributing clothes etc . -
They are much in need of footwear donations I believe . When I asked them about duvets they were a little divided - on the one hand v useful for ppl moving into accomodation ,on the other runs the danger of bumping up the luggage they take with them and the taxi drivers refusing to take them . Which apparently ,if too much luggage they do .

I think maybe the whole concept of a CPZ appeals to ppl who think it will guarantee them a parking space near their house in exchange for a fee, I've known friends in CPZ and their experience has been a reduction in parking spaces and a continuing difficulty in finding a space . Factor in the domino effect caused by a CPZ in one road to adjacent streets , increased complexity for parking for carers ( formal and informal ) and my own personal fear which is that CPZs encourage the turning of front gardens into hard surfaced car parking areas then it seems less of the soloution that some think . -
